Transaction 74c99e4d5f101ae730be697a81a29d683289990baea26ff78a2afc7f17e58f4f
1 Input
1 Output
-
74c99e4d5f101ae730be697a81a29d683289990baea26ff78a2afc7f17e58f4f:0
- value
- 703730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afdcf6005a8dccb6f2b435a979c0b7ea88b2cd84 OP_EQUAL
- address
- 3HitskRhpHZpMY3r7r9aU2opHGQwgmazZp